Hawaii Foodbank and its neighbor island food distribution partners have received $39,771.51, or the equivalent of 66,286 pounds of rice, from 29 credit unions on Oahu, Hawaii island, Maui and Kauai.
The “Have a Rice Day” fundraising event ran from Sept. 9-Nov. 10. Each credit union gave away plastic rice paddles, imprinted with the credit union’s logo, to those who donated 20-pound bags of rice or cash equivalents.
Money received and the rice donations were distributed to Hawaii Foodbank, Maui Food Bank, The Food Basket (Hawaii island) and Hawaii Foodbank — Kauai.
